Analcime
specimen number:
4751071
location:
Phoenix mine, Keweenaw Co., Michigan, USA
description:
A grouping of glassy translucent colorless analcime crystals to 1.0 cm in size. This is in great condition. This is ex Yale University Peabody Museum collection. Paperwork as shown at the end of the video. There seems to have been some discussion as to whether these are twinned crystals or not, I personally do not think so.
